EDI and the need for appropriate logging

Over the years at DMS Group, we have helped several clients with their EDI [Electronic Data Interchange] implementations. Most solutions have been X12 based in either manufacturing or automotive sectors. The majority have been BizTalk Server based implementations, which has a stronger heritage in this space but recently Azure has rounded out its B2B services to enable closer equivalence in functionality. Regardless of which tooling you use, the one thing we guarantee you’ll need for your EDI implementation is appropriate logging.

Imagine you get a call from that important client. They want to confirm you received a critical 850 (Purchase Order). They claim they sent it yesterday but have received no acknowledgment. Frankly, you’d like to confirm that too. That order is important to your business. If you hadn’t already guessed it, this would be a bad time to find out that you really didn’t want the entire team depending on your overworked technology team to wade through verbose logs (that may or may not exist depending on what was configured) so that you can confirm a critical business receipt.

So what to do? First, absolutely  be sure to include appropriate EDI logging as part of any EDI solution delivery. By “appropriate” we mean is should include the ability for non-technical business users to easily search and view key EDI values that sufficiently enable their roles and keep the business smoothly running.

While you can start with the out of the box tooling in Azure and BizTalk respectively, they can be limiting and both tend to overly depend on your technology teams to access. Our recommendation is that most EDI business teams will likely need something more. A better options would be to consider tools like Kovai’s Turbo360 and BizTalk360 offerings. Remember a line of code you don’t write means a line of code you don’t have to support 🙂 That said, if you need it, you can always roll your own or get DMS to build you a custom coded logging and reporting solution. This maybe appropriate if you need more granular control or if you need it integrated into other software your EDI operators use daily.
